
Lifeboat Institutions
Lifeboat institutions are organizations dedicated to maritime safety, specifically tasked with saving lives at sea. They operate rescue ships, provide emergency assistance, and support maritime safety standards. Established through government or maritime authorities, their goal is to effectively respond to distress calls, assist vessels in danger, and ensure the safety of sailors and passengers. These institutions often collaborate internationally, sharing resources and information to improve rescue operations. Their work is essential for minimizing loss of life and property at sea, especially in dangerous or emergency situations, functioning as a vital safety net for maritime navigation.
